NAFR HIGH COURT OF CHHATTISGARH, BILASPUR WPC NO.7952 of 2011 Lekhram Sahu, son of late Mehtaru, aged 54 years, resident of Dagania, Thakur Pyarelal Singh Ward, Tehsil and District Raipur (CG) ----Petitioner

Versus

1. Municipal Corporation, Raipur, a body constituted under the relevant provisions of the Chhattisgarh Municipal Corporation Act, 1956, having its office at Byron Bazar, Raipur (CG)

2. Commissioner, Municipal Corporation, Raipur

3. Zone Commissioner, Zone No.5, Municipal Corporation, Raipur (CG) ---- Respondents 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- For Petitioner :

Mr.B.P.Sharma, Advocate For Respondents :

Mr.Kasif Shakeel, Advocate 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Hon'ble Shri Justice Sanjay K. Agrawal Order on Board 17/07/2018

1. Learned counsel for the petitioner would submit that house of the petitioner has been demolished despite interim order of this Court, therefore, the respondent-Corporation be directed to determine and pay compensation which the petitioner is entitled.

2. On the other hand, learned counsel for the respondents would submit that title has not been established.

3. Be that as it may, the petitioner is granted four weeks time to make representation before the respondent-Corporation along with requisite documents. If such a representation is made, the respondent-Corporation would do well to dispose of the same within a period of six weeks from its receipt along with certified copy of this order by speaking and reasoned order.

4. With the aforesaid aforesaid observation, the writ petition finally stands disposed of. No cost(s).
